我是PHP的新手,我很困惑地看到一些示例调用带有@mysql_ping()的@前缀的函数.
它是为了什么?谷歌搜索/搜索没有太大的帮助,因为@被丢弃,'别名'不是足够好的关键字.
@抑制错误,警告和通知.
如果您使用自定义错误处理程序或对$ php_errormsg变量进行适当检查来补充它,您可以将它用于良好目的,以便您可以正确处理错误.
根据我的经验,这种正确的用法并不是很常见,而是以不好的方式使用了很多,只是为了隐藏错误而不对它们采取行动.
更多信息请访问http://www.php.net/manual/en/language.operators.errorcontrol.php